Synonyms, Thesaurus & Antonyms of 'dismay' Princeton's WordNet 

1. (noun) discouragement, disheartenment, dismay
the feeling of despair in the face of obstacles
Synonyms: alarm, dismay, disheartenment, discouragement, consternation

2. (verb) alarm, dismay, consternation
fear resulting from the awareness of danger
Synonyms: warning device, alarum, warning signal, consternation, alarm clock, alarm, alert, alarm system, discouragement, dismay, disheartenment

3. (verb) depress, deject, cast down, get down, dismay, dispirit, demoralize, demoralise
lower someone's spirits; make downhearted

4. (verb) dismay, alarm, appal, appall, horrify
fill with apprehension or alarm; cause to be unpleasantly surprised
